Transaction 3e3a77914bdec7864b8acc0d78d3fe247efc4628d00ec205b8f1dd353ae2942f
1 Input
1 Output
-
3e3a77914bdec7864b8acc0d78d3fe247efc4628d00ec205b8f1dd353ae2942f:0
- value
- 1531497
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21bf072c0c5d717c72ea2c5164344c5902bd1d5d OP_EQUALVERIFY OP_CHECKSIG
- address
- 145S9BzwBbbZzcC3QLvKDWRzW4FLsPZiVs